Output 859d55000f8e88b10b3b3fba34d0a31dc1162ad217fafb0e976546c98b9f60bf:0

value
26929102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c84cfe5f694e9bd0963cac775755273b0ac3cbe OP_EQUAL
address
3QiDJqC4sPuaGUoCSHsPeGFq323maH3GwT
transaction
859d55000f8e88b10b3b3fba34d0a31dc1162ad217fafb0e976546c98b9f60bf
spent
true